Your Approval Odds After a Divorce

Lenders are less concerned with your marital status and more interested in your individual financial stability moving forward. After a divorce, they will primarily assess:

  • Your Sole Income: This includes your employment income, as well as consistent spousal or child support payments, which can be used to qualify.
  • Your Personal Credit Report: They will look at how you've managed credit in your own name. If you have limited individual credit history, getting a car loan is an excellent way to build it.
  • Debt-to-Income Ratio: Lenders want to see that your total monthly debt payments (including the new car loan) don't exceed a certain percentage (usually 40-45%) of your gross monthly income.

Frequently Asked Questions

Will my ex-spouse's bad credit affect my car loan application in Nunavut?

Once you are legally separated and apply for a loan as an individual, lenders will evaluate your application based on your own credit history, income, and debt. Your ex-spouse's credit score will not be a factor unless you are still financially linked through co-signed debts that are in arrears.

How much income do I need to get an SUV loan in Nunavut after a divorce?

Most lenders require a minimum gross monthly income of around $1,800-$2,000. However, the key factor is your debt-to-income ratio. Your total monthly debt payments (rent, credit cards, other loans, plus the estimated car payment) should ideally not exceed 40-45% of your gross income.

Is a 60-month loan term a good idea for an SUV?

A 60-month (5-year) term is very common for financing SUVs. It offers a balance between a manageable monthly payment and paying off the vehicle in a reasonable timeframe. While longer terms can lower the payment further, you'll pay more in total interest over the life of the loan.

Can I get a car loan if I'm receiving spousal or child support?

Yes, absolutely. Lenders consider spousal and child support as qualifying income, provided the payments are consistent and documented through a court order or separation agreement. This income can significantly improve your ability to get approved for the loan you need.

Why is there no tax calculated for my Nunavut car loan?

Nunavut is unique in Canada as it does not have a Provincial Sales Tax (PST). This calculator is set to 0% to reflect this advantage, which significantly lowers the total amount you need to finance. Be aware that the 5% federal Goods and Services Tax (GST) typically still applies to the purchase of new vehicles.
